ABOUT THE PLAN OF ACTION

The Plan of Action to Integrate Volunteering into the 2030 Agenda is a framework under the auspices of the United Nations (UN) through which governments, volunteer-involving organizations, UN agencies, private sector, civil society and academia come together to strengthen people’s ownership of the 2030 Agenda; integrate volunteering in national strategies and policies; and measure the contribution of volunteering to the SDGs.

PLAN OF ACTION TO INTEGRATE VOLUNTEERING INTO THE 2030 AGENDA  

In July 2020, UNV and IFRC co-organized a global technical meeting on 'Reimagining Volunteering for the 2030 Agenda'. Stakeholders from around the world joined the discussions and made their voices heard.
